GPS satellites broadcast radio frequency signals at two carrier frequencies; L1 (1575.42 MHz) and L2 (1227.60 MHz). The beams that can be used by the general public are encoded using C/A (rough/acquisition) codes, while beams used solely by the US military are encoded using P (precise) codes.
The C/A code includes the identification codes and navigation messages of each satellite. The L1 signal from the GPS satellite is phase modulated using C/A code. C/A code is a digital signal in which 0 and 1 are encoded by 1023 consecutive digital pulse patterns. The navigation message consists of 25 frames, each with 5 subframes of 300 bits. Therefore, each frame has 1500 bits (0 and 1). The data length of each bit is 20 milliseconds (i.e., the total pulse width of a C/A signal of one bit is 20 milliseconds).
The orbital data of each satellite is called an ephemeris. This data is used to generate the precise position of the satellite, which is required for the GPS receiver to calculate position information. The orbital data of all satellites is called the almanac. It includes rough orbit and status information of all satellites in the network. This data is used to locate available satellites for the GPS receiver so that it can find their current time and position on Earth.
